AB  - The European Community and its member states regularly invest large volumes of funding and effort in the development of HPC technologies in Europe. However, some observers express the criticism that these investments are either unfocused, lack long-term perspectives, or that their results are not mature enough to be adopted by the mainstream developments, which limits their benefit for the European HPC community, industry and society. This paper is intended as a counterexample to this pessimistic view. It describes the success story of Modular Supercomputing Architecture, which started in 2011 with the EU-funded R&D project “DEEP”, and is now being adopted by large-scale supercomputing centres across the old continent and worldwide. Main hardware and software characteristics of the architecture and some of the systems using it are described, complemented by a historical view of its development, the lessons learned in the process and future prospects.
